July 11th: World Population Day
This day is dedicated to raising awareness of global population issues. It is observed annually on July 11 to focus attention on the urgency and importance of population issues. The primary goal of World Population Day is to raise awareness about the complex challenges and opportunities associated with population dynamics. This includes discussions about family planning, gender equality, poverty, maternal health, human rights, and the environment. You can participate by educating yourself, supporting related organizations, and talking about the issues. This day is a chance to discuss global challenges and the importance of responsible action.
July 18th: International Nelson Mandela Day
A day to honor the legacy of Nelson Mandela and celebrate his contributions to the struggle for democracy and human rights. This day focuses on recognizing Mandela's values and dedication to fighting for a better world. People are encouraged to dedicate their time to helping others and making a positive impact on their communities. You can participate in volunteer work, support human rights initiatives, or simply learn more about Mandela's life and work. This is a fantastic day to reflect on service, kindness, and making the world a better place.
